: Sierra Wireless andBosch Software Innovationswill showcase a connected greenhouse designed to optimize harvests, with sensors to measure humidity, temperature and luminosity for different plants. Visitors can monitor the plants conditions through a dashboard and see how a humidifier automatically waters the plants when the soil gets too dry. Both the humidifier and the sensor are connected via the Bosch IoT Suites device and gateway management. This allows users to remotely control the devices and send data through a Sierra Wireless gateway based on themangOH® Red open source platformand aWP8548 embedded moduletightly integrated withsmart connectivity services.

: Sierra Wireless andGirbauwill showcase Sapphire, Girbaus new remote monitoring service for laundry machines, which is transforming the commercial laundry business. Visitors can see how Girbaus IoT Kit connected to the washing machine collects and transmits machine data through Sierra WirelessFX30 programmable IoT gatewayandsmart connectivity servicesto the Sapphire app. Laundry operators use the app to monitor and manage their entire fleet of machines and can be alerted to potential issues, reducing downtime and costs.

Sierra Wireless (SWIR) (SW.TO), the leading provider of fully integrated device-to-cloud solutions for the Internet of Things (IoT), today announced that the company will showcase its solutions for the Internet of Things (IoT) at Mobile World Congress 2018, which takes place February 26 – March 1, at Fira Gran Via in Barcelona, Spain.

Sierra Wireless will exhibit in the GSMA Innovation City, Hall 4, stand 4A30, demonstrating how the company is empowering customers to reimagine their future in a connected world, creating a better future in all facets of life, including:

: Sierra Wireless andXSunwill showcase a flight simulation of XSuns 4.5m-wide, solar-powered drone monitoring a pipeline between France and Spain. Visitors will experience XSuns Control Center application and see all drone data reliably transmitted through Sierra WirelessAirLink® RV50 gatewayand multi-operatorsmart connectivity services. Sierra WirelessAirVantage® IoT platformis used to measure data consumption and manage the drone fleet lifecycle. The solar-powered drone is targeted at agricultural, sea, land and infrastructure surveillance.

Sierra Wireless (SWIR) (SW.TO) is an IoT pioneer, empowering businesses and industries to transform and thrive in the connected economy. Customers Start with Sierra because we offer a device to cloud solution, comprised of embedded and networking solutions seamlessly integrated with our secure cloud and connectivity services. OEMs and enterprises worldwide rely on our expertise in delivering fully integrated solutions to reduce complexity, turn data into intelligence and get their connected products and services to market faster. Sierra Wireless has 1,400 employees globally and operates R&D centers in North America, Europe and Asia. For more information, visit

: Sierra Wireless andIntelliniumwill showcase an LPWA-connected shoe designed to improve worker safety. Visitors can see how a force sensor membrane triggered in the safety shoe sends an alert to a tablet monitored by the employer or colleagues, as well as a variety of feedback options that can be sent back to the worker through vibrations in the shoe. Intelliniums safety shoe is equipped with a Sierra WirelessHL7 series embedded moduletightly integrated withsmart connectivity servicesto ensure mission-critical communication.
